Abstract

It was made an hourly sampling of a set of aerometric variates in a place of Centro Habana during two intervals of 10 days
in the wet and dry seasons of the year 1980. Pollutant levels fluc­tuations were connected to urban heat island picture at glance. Pe­ripheral wind of the city from East and South were related to higher values of sulphuric acidity. Otherwise, wind direction from North
and South showed connection to higher smoke concentration amounts. Power spectra suggested persistence and cycles weighted according variate and time interval. Significant coherences were located in the correlation structure under different phase relations. Sorne of them appeared twice in the time lapses, another changed. It was believed that everything observed resembled tracks of a unstable time depen­dent dynamic in the aerometric system in urban area.
